M546 YEV is a 1995 Triumph Sprint in Green with a 885c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.5%.
Across all 1995 Triumph Sprint models, the average MOT pass rate is 84.3% with a typical mileage of 30,858 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Triumph Sprint fails its MOT is t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m, accounting for 1,971 recorded failures. If you're considering buying M546 YEV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Triumph Sprint typ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 31 years old, this Triumph Sprint is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
